i am looking for some help with my 76 125,ktm motor with a bing carb.  once i get the thing started it runs like the champ that it is, how ever there inlies my problem.  starting this bike cold is getting to be quite a prosess, start by kicking and kicking and ect... so after a few deep breaths off the oxygen, pull out the spark plug, its soaked, replace,repeat,same outcome. so the third time i remove the soaked plug, pour about two cap fulls of gas directly into cylinder,put soaked plug back in and presto off she goes.it will spew nasty stuff out the exaust port for a while also. after the bike is warm it will start on the first kick everytime,hmmm. the carb is spotless inside and out,the float levels are correct, and the motor has a fresh top end.   HELP

Please don't get offended, but are you using the "tickler" to prime the carb? My 77 400 GS6 has a Bing 38 on it and I "tickle" the carb until gas runs out of the overflow tubes.....Move the choke lever on the handlebars to the "on" position and it's usually a 2 kick start from there. Once it's started I move the choke lever to the normal position.
